Mismatched cables does not hurt. Best to go with matched set. INCLUDING the cables to controller and motor.

Using upgraded cables on batteries and normal cables "Bottlenecks" at regular cable.
The net result is little if any gain from the upgraded cables.

Since you will be replacing parts, good idea to use better quality parts.

The stuff on the cart is the lowest cost equipment the Mfg. could use for carts design use.
Golf-- Drive a few hundred feet ,stop for a minute or two ,drive a few hundred feet.
with 2 people and 2 golf bags for about 12 miles a day at 13mph max.

messing with the existing batteries do to money. I charged each one got each one to 8V. put it on charge. ran ok seemed to have some power and lost a little going up a little hill. I understand. what I do not understand is that the batteries keep loosing water from the cells. I fill them up and after a charge I see the cells again. where is the water going or is the water just so low do to neglect. they are not leaking.
other issue is I have 4 batteries that are 8V and two that are like 6V. I can not seem to kick start the two batteries to 8V.
why does the golf cart now shimmy when I floor it but gradual pedal it is fine. I took the seat off and floored it and the rear end bounces up and down.
any one have ideas
thanks
mike
Sounds like the water is boiling out of your batteries as the 2 battery that are only holding 6 volts will cause the charger to continually charge all battery in an attempt to bring the overall pack voltage up....

why does the golf cart now shimmy when I floor it
When you floor it - you place a high amperage demand on your (bad) batteries. Your pack voltage momentarily plummets and causes the motor/controller to "shimmy". Its often called the DEATH RATTLE. If you replace only the two ultra-bad batteries, the two new ones will be damaged within a year, trying to make-up for the remaining four "lazy/old" ones. They ALL need replacing, I'm afraid.

Maybe you can find a set of six good-used batteries at a battery dealer (1 to 2 years old max) since money is an issue. Don't buy non-golf-cart batteries, or that will create a whole new set of problems for you.
